Core Functionality and Design Philosophy
This personalization tool operates as a resource pack for compatible third-party launchers, not a standalone application. Its primary function is to replace default application icons with a curated set exceeding 10,000 individual icons. The design is characterized by consistent linear outlines, vibrant color palettes, and rounded geometric forms. The objective is to eliminate visual clutter and inconsistency between app designs, creating a streamlined and intentional visual flow across your device's home screen and app drawer.
Technical Features and Customization Depth
The pack integrates through a dedicated application that serves as a browser and management hub. A categorized organizational system allows for efficient icon sorting and retrieval. Key technical features include a dynamic calendar icon that updates daily, a material-themed dashboard for navigation, and specialized folder icons that maintain the pack's aesthetic. For launchers with app drawer theming support, such as Nova Launcher, the pack offers specific settings to customize this area independently. A built-in request system allows users to submit icons for missing applications, with updates frequently released to expand coverage.
Implementation and Compatibility Requirements
To function, the Pixel Icon Pack requires a compatible third-party launcher installed. It is tested and confirmed to work with launchers including Nova, Action, ADW, Apex, and Smart Launcher. For launchers like Microsoft Launcher or Poco Launcher, application typically occurs within the launcher's own theme or icon settings menu. It is important to note that default system launchers like Google Now Launcher are not supported. For optimal visual results, particularly with Nova Launcher, it is recommended to disable icon normalization and adjust icon size to a range between 100% and 120% within the launcher's settings. The accompanying app also provides a streamlined "Apply" section for batch operations and offers a rotating selection of complementary wallpapers.
